Police reports published Sept. 27

Tonawanda News — City of Tonawanda 

VIOLATION: John M. Ferenc, 83, of Fletcher Street, was charged at 9:15 a.m. Wednesday with criminal contempt, for violating an order of protection related to a domestic incident. He was held for court. 

North Tonawanda 

HARASSMENT: Brittany M. King, 23, 30 Seventh Ave., was charged at 8:55 p.m. Tuesday with second-degree harassment. She was released for court. 

RESISTING: Mark E. Kaszub, 55, 964 Pioneer Drive, was charged at 1:10 a.m. Wednesday with second-degree obstructing government administration, resisting arrest and second-degree harassment. He was held for court. 

POSSESSION: Steven M. Greger, 25, Buffalo, was charged at 11:28 a.m. Wednesday with violation of probation, third-degree criminal sale of a controlled substance, third-degree possession of a controlled substance and resisting arrest. Greger was held for court.
